Output 78559ae4f28e6b507634d7d4dade8495e4c4c651da7989a66f79fc3f05eb2c5d:1

value
20069881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aeca7e963571d69a76f18d511a7175d906fec79 OP_EQUAL
address
35byojwa3hd12BZ3ZWS4vRAZmehoWvvPa1
transaction
78559ae4f28e6b507634d7d4dade8495e4c4c651da7989a66f79fc3f05eb2c5d
spent
true